Age Levels
Six years old to adult. Generally, we recommend that students be at least 6 years old for guitar lessons. This is because it requires a little more physical strength and coordination to play the instrument. That being said, it also depends somewhat on an individual’s body size.

Practice Recommendations
We recommend that each student practice for 20 to 30 minutes per day, five days a week. This allows for the maximum benefit and enjoyment from taking lessons.
